Walmart To Go is a new delivery service that lets you order grocery items online.
They offer Walmart’s Every Day Low Prices online so you can save money and save time! Just shop and pay online to purchase products in stock at a Walmart store near you, choose a delivery date, and your order will be delivered right to you!
